WebSep 3, 2024 · Put vaseline around your ears, your neckline and where your forehead meets your hairline to help protect it from the dye. Step 2. Put on your hair dyeing shirt and your gloves and then put your color of choice into your (clean) mixing bowl. Step 3. Apply the color to your hair from the roots to tip.

If your hair is past your shoulders, or shoulder-length and extremely coarse, use two boxes of the same shade to ensure full coverage. Just make sure to mix the dyes in a glass or plastic bowl — a metal one will oxidize the dye and cause it to change color.
